"Havengezicht in Hamburg," created between 1851 and 1924, is a graphite drawing by Dutch artist Carel Nicolaas Storm van 's-Gravesande. The artwork depicts a bustling harbor scene in Hamburg, Germany, with numerous ships and a cityscape in the background. The drawing's focus on the water and its dynamic movement creates a sense of depth and energy, while the hazy atmosphere emphasizes the industrial nature of the scene. It captures the bustling activity of a European port in the late 19th century and is housed in the Rijksmuseum.
